Here is interesting experiment in seeing when and how a nortb-only triggering ball effect will turn on and off a SS mosfet relay using 20mm wide neodymium rotor magnets arranged NSNS around in a flat disc rotor. Look how a North face behaves normal, but interesting is that a South face also triggers too, but just for only a very short blip right above the leading and trailing edges of th S magnet face.
